Title: Innovations and Contributions of Yu-Hsiang Chen in Semiconductor Technology
Introduction: Yu-Hsiang Chen, based in Hsinchu, Taiwan, has made significant contributions to the field of semiconductor technology, with a notable portfolio of 19 patents. His work reflects a deep understanding of semiconductor devices and innovative methods for improving their performance and efficiency.
Latest Patents: Among his latest patents, Yu-Hsiang Chen has developed methods for forming semiconductor devices. One patent outlines a method for forming a transistor that includes a channel region, gate region, and source/drain regions, as well as a front-side interconnect structure that enhances connectivity. Another notable patent describes a semiconductor device structure that incorporates a resistive element surrounded by dielectric layers, showcasing a sophisticated design that optimizes electrical connections.
Career Highlights: Yu-Hsiang Chen has been associated with prominent companies in the semiconductor industry, including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company Limited. His experience in developing cutting-edge semiconductor technologies has established him as an influential figure in the field.
Collaborations: Throughout his career, Yu-Hsiang Chen has collaborated with notable colleagues such as Wen-Sheh Huang and Chii-Ping Chen. These collaborations have fostered innovation and driven advancements within the semiconductor sector.
